Correction Detail.

This is a more extensive detailing treatment, which includes up to 4 stages of machine polishing during the paint correction process.   • Vehicle snow foamed and washed using the two-bucket method.

  • Wheels washed using a selection of wheel brushes and none-acidic cleaners.

  • Paintwork subjected to a three-stage decontamination process to removed bonded contaminants.

  • Vehicle rinsed and then dried using a selection of deep pile drying towels and a dedicated vehicle blow dryer.

  • Paint thickness is recorded using multiple paint thickness gauges.

  • Paintwork is carefully machine polished using multiple stages for optimum results.

  • Paintwork and glass sealed using a wax or polymer sealant.

  • Wheels removed for deep cleaning and sealing.

  • Interior dusted, cleaned, and vacuumed.

  • Tyres and trims dressed. 

  • Final dust down and inspection prior to vehicle handover.
